This is a major, rapidly developing story — and it's happening today. Here's what's going on:

The core dispute: Anthropic has had a $200 million contract with the Pentagon (now called the "Department of War" by the Trump administration) since last July. The military wanted to use Claude for "all lawful purposes," but Anthropic maintained two key restrictions: Claude should not be used for mass domestic surveillance of Americans or for fully autonomous weapons systems (i.e., weapons that fire without human oversight).

The escalation: Defense Secretary Pete Hegseth set a deadline of 5:01 PM today (February 27) for Anthropic to drop those safeguards. The threats were dramatic — the Pentagon warned it would designate Anthropic a "supply chain risk," a label normally reserved for adversarial foreign companies like Huawei, which would effectively blacklist Anthropic from doing business with the government or government contractors. They also floated invoking the Defense Production Act to compel compliance.

Anthropic's response: CEO Dario Amodei drew a firm line, stating the company "cannot in good conscience accede" KPBS to the Pentagon's demands. Anthropic also pointed out that the Pentagon's two threats were self-contradictory — one labels them a security risk, the other labels Claude as essential to national security. ABC News

Trump's announcement: Earlier today, President Trump ordered all federal agencies to "immediately cease" use of Anthropic's technology, with a six-month wind-down period. CBS News He threatened "major civil and criminal consequences" if Anthropic doesn't cooperate during the transition.

Why it's a big deal: Claude was the only AI model currently used in the military's classified systems Axios, including reportedly being used in the operation to capture Nicolás Maduro. Defense officials themselves admitted it would be a "huge pain in the ass" to disentangle. Axios Companies like Palantir, which uses Claude for sensitive military work, will now need to find alternatives.

Broader industry reaction: Notably, OpenAI's Sam Altman said his company would push for the same restrictions Anthropic sought, and over 100 Google employees signed a letter asking for similar limits on Gemini. On the other side, Elon Musk's xAI agreed to the Pentagon's "all lawful purposes" terms, and Musk accused Anthropic of hating "Western civilization."

The fundamental question at stake is whether private AI companies can set ethical guardrails on how the government uses their technology — and the Trump administration's answer, at least for now, appears to be a hard no.
